Angels Recovery is a licensed mental health and addiction treatment practice based in Georgia with over 35 years of experience serving individuals, families, and communities.

 

Our approach is warm and interactive. We believe in treating everyone with respect, sensitivity, and compassion, and we don’t believe in stigmatizing labels. We tailor our dialogue and treatment plans to meet each client’s unique and specific needs.

 

We provide multicultural behavioral health and addiction treatment, specializing in trauma — including racial, historical, and generational trauma — as well as anxiety and depression. Our team is bilingual (Spanish and English) and takes a holistic approach to mental health care. We listen without judgment and work with you to get the most out of life, no matter your circumstances. Our approach uses an integrated theoretical orientation incorporating research-supported therapies to help clients integrate all aspects of well-being.

Karina Valles, Counselor, CADC-II

Karina Valles, Counselor, CADC-II

Intake Coordinator/Counselor
Karina Valles has dedicated her career to supporting individuals on their journey to recovery since joining Angels Recovery in 2008. Starting as an executive assistant, Karina’s passion for helping others and her commitment to growth propelled her into her current role as a counselor, where she specializes in substance use disorders and trauma-informed care. She provides individual counseling under the supervision of Lizz Toledo, LCSW, and brings a compassionate, client-centered approach to every session. Karina holds a CADC-II certification through ADCBGA and is a certified Youth Mental Health First Aider. She actively pursues continuing education to stay current with best practices and evidence-based modalities. Her academic journey began with a Bachelor’s degree in Psychology from Georgia State University, and she is currently pursuing a Master of Social Work (MSW) at the University of Georgia, with a focus on micro-level social work. Upon completing her MSW, Karina is preparing to transition into a leadership position within Angels Recovery, while also expanding her impact through private practice, continuing her work in trauma-informed care. Deeply committed to serving underserved communities, Karina has a strong connection to the Latino community and proudly offers bilingual services in English and Spanish. Her work is guided by a calling to advocate for equity in mental health and recovery services, ensuring that individuals from all backgrounds have access to compassionate, culturally competent care. Karina believes in empowering individuals through empathy, education, and evidence-based practices, helping them build resilience and reclaim their lives.
